GARLIC DILL NEW POTATOES



Garlic Dill New Potatoes image

Potatoes are tossed in a garlicky dill butter before being served in this fantastic side dish.

Provided by kelcampbell

Categories     Side Dish     Potato Side Dish Recipes

Time 20m

Yield 5

Number Of Ingredients 5

8 medium red potatoes, cubed
3 tablespoons butter, melted
1 tablespoon chopped fresh dill
2 teaspoons minced garlic
¼ teaspoon salt

Steps:

  • Place the potatoes in a steamer basket, and set in a pan over an inch of boiling water. Cover, and steam for about 10 minutes, until potatoes are tender but not mushy.
  • In a small bowl, stir together the butter, dill, garlic, and salt. Transfer the potatoes to a serving bowl, and pour the seasoned butter over them. Toss gently until they are well-coated.

STEWED POTATOES



Stewed Potatoes image

Diced potatoes stewed with onions, garlic, tomatoes, and rutabaga in broth. Chicken, beef, or vegetable broth may be used.

Provided by Marta Olynyk

Categories     Side Dish     Potato Side Dish Recipes

Time 35m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 tablespoon vegetable oil
3 cloves garlic, minced
½ large onion, chopped
1 plum tomato, chopped
6 potatoes, diced
½ rutabaga, diced
dried oregano, to taste
sal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
2 cups chicken broth

Steps:

  • Heat the oil in a skillet over medium heat, and saute the garlic and onion until tender. Stir in the tomato, and cook until heated through. Mix in potatoes and rutabaga. Season with oregano, salt, and pepper. Pour in the broth, and bring to a boil. Reduce heat to low, and continue cooking 15 minutes, or until potatoes and rutabaga are tender.

STEWED POTATOES WITH DILL (POMMES DE TERRE A L'ETOUFFEE)



Stewed Potatoes with Dill (Pommes de Terre a l'Etouffee) image

Provided by Pierre Franey

Categories     side dish

Time 10m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 8

6 small new red, waxy potatoes, about 1 1/2 pounds
2 tablespoons butter
1 small onion, halved and thinly sliced, about 1 cup
1 bay leaf
Salt to taste, if desired
Freshly ground pepper to taste
1 1/2 cups chicken broth
1 tablespoon finely chopped dill

Steps:

  • Rinse and drain the potatoes well. Do not peel. Cut them in quarter-inch-thick slices. There should be about four cups.
  • Heat the butter in a saucepan and add the onion. Cook, stirring, until wilted. Add the potato slices, bay leaf, salt, pepper and broth.
  • Bring to a simmer. Cover tightly and cook slowly about five minutes.
  • Uncover and cook until the liquid is evaporated. Serve sprinkled with the chopped dill.

POMMES DE TERRE LORETTE



Pommes de Terre Lorette image

Categories     Potato     Side     Fry     Vegetarian     Gourmet     Sugar Conscious     Pescatarian     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     No Sugar Added     Kosher

Yield Makes 6 to 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 19

For duchesse potatoes
1 lb medium boiling potatoes
1 tablespoon unsalted butter
1 whole large egg
1 large egg yolk
1 1/4 teaspoons salt
1/8 teaspoon black pepper
For pâte à choux
1/2 cup water
1 tablespoon unsalted butter
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on black pepper
1/8 teaspoon freshly grated nutmeg
1/2 cup all-purpose flour
2 large eggs
For frying
About 4 cups vegetable oil
Special Equipment
a potato ricer; a pastry bag fitted with a 1/2-inch star tip; a deep-fat thermometer

Steps:

  • Make duchesse potatoes:
  • Peel potatoes and cut into 1-inch pieces. Cover potatoes with cold salted water by 1 inch in a 2-quart pot, then simmer, uncovered, until tender, about 15 minutes.
  • Drain potatoes in a colander and return to pot. Dry potatoes by shaking pot over low heat until all moisture is evaporated and a film begins to appear on bottom of pot, about 2 minutes.
  • Force potatoes through ricer into a bowl. Add butter, whole egg and yolk, salt, and pepper and stir with a wooden spoon until very smooth. Keep potato mixture warm, covered.
  • Make pâte à choux:
  • Bring water, butter, salt, pepper, and nutmeg to a boil in a 1-quart heavy saucepan over high heat, then reduce heat to moderate.
  • Add flour all at once and stir briskly with a wooden spoon until mixture pulls away from side of pan, 1 to 2 minutes. Remove from heat and cool slightly, about 3 minutes. Add eggs 1 at a time, stirring well after each addition. Add potato mixture and stir until combined well. Transfer mixture to pastry bag.
  • Form and fry potatoes:
  • Put oven rack in middle position and preheat oven to 200°F.
  • Heat 2 inches oil in a 5- to 6-quart heavy pot over moderately high heat until thermometer registers 370°F.
  • Resting metal tip of pastry bag on edge of pot, pipe 8 (2-inch) lengths of potato mixture directly into oil (use caution when piping into hot oil), using a small knife or kitchen shears to cut off each length of dough at tip of bag. Fry potatoes, turning over once with a slotted spoon, until crisp, golden, and cooked through, 2 to 3 minutes. Transfer to paper towels to drain briefly. Fry remaining potato mixture in batches in same manner.
  • Transfer potatoes as fried and drained to a metal rack set in a large shallow baking pan in oven to keep them crisp and warm until ready to serve.

POMMES DE TERRE A L'ETOUFFEE (PAN FRIED POTATOES)



Pommes De Terre a L'etouffee (Pan Fried Potatoes) image

Make and share this Pommes De Terre a L'etouffee (Pan Fried Potatoes) recipe from Food.com.

Provided by lindseylcw

Categories     Breakfast

Time 40m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 4

2 kg potatoes
2 onions
4 garlic cloves
150 ml canola oil

Steps:

  • peel and wash potatoes and cut into very thin slices.
  • chop peeled onions and garlic finely.
  • heat oil in heavy iron casserole and add the potato slices in layers with onion and garlic and seasoning in between.
  • cover the pan and cook over medium to brisk heat.
  • at first sign of steam take a large flat spoon or fllodslice and turn the potatoes over, in sections, to cook on the other side.
  • Do this twice BUT ONLY TWICE more.
  • after 25-30 mins of cooking time serve at once.
  • Note; if potatoes tend to stick to pan lower heat, DO NOT ADD ANY LIQUID.

POMMES DE TERRE SOUFFLéES | TRADITIONAL POTATO DISH FROM FRANCE
The potatoes are thinly sliced into uniform slices, then thoroughly dried before being fried. Once fried, the potato slices are removed from the oil and allowed to chill before being fried for a second time in even hotter oil until puffed up, crispy, and golden brown.
